Posting Summary: The Division of Enrollment Management at Teachers College, Columbia University, is seeking a Director of Enrollment Marketing to serve as a strategic leader in shaping the student journey. This incumbent will design and drive high-impact, multi-channel marketing strategies that engage and inspire prospective students from initial discovery through enrollment.
Job Summary/Basic Function: The Director of Enrollment Marketing is a critical role in the Division of Enrollment Management and will report to the Vice President of Enrollment Management. The incumbent will be expected to lead the strategy, execution, and performance of integrated, multi-channel marketing efforts targeting prospective, applicant, admitted, and enrolling students. The Director will be responsible for elevating the visibility, reputation, and market positioning of Teachers College and its academic programs to achieve enrollment goals globally across degree types. The Director will oversee the full enrollment marketing lifecycle from awareness through yield - leveraging data-driven strategies, compelling storytelling, and optimized digital and traditional channels. The incumbent will supervise the Enrollment Marketing team, comprising full-time and student staff.

Teachers College, Columbia University, is the oldest and largest graduate school of education in the United States, and also perennially ranked among the nation's best. Its name notwithstanding, the College is committed to a vision of education writ large, encompassing our four core areas of expertise: health, education, leadership and psychology.
